Industrial Electrician

 

PABCO® Gypsum, a division of PABCO® Building Products LLC, has provided quality gypsum board products and service for over 35 years.  PABCO® Gypsum supplies a complete line of gypsum products for commercial and residential construction.

The Newark, CA location is currently accepting resumes for an Electrician.  This position is responsible for troubleshooting and repairing all electrical equipment and controls, mechanical equipment and instrumentation. 

 

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:  

  • Works extended hours and responds to repair calls at any hour of the day to keep facility in operation.
  • Ability to troubleshoot and repair all electrical and simple mechanical and instrumental equipment.
  • Ability to read blue prints and technical drawings.
  • Ability to design and assemble motor starters.
  • Ability to design and assemble electrical controls.
  • Ability to read and troubleshoot pneumatic and hydraulic schematics.
  • Ability to run conduit, pulls wires and make connections with a minimum of assistance.
  • Ability to do simple welding.
  • Knowledge of AC Drive.
  • Ability to order and reorder parts.
  • Records daily activities in logbook.
  • Ability to assemble motor starter and other circuits.
  • Troubleshoots and repairs field instruments.
  • Troubleshoots PLC, VFD, AC Drive and HMI equipment.
  • Maintain excellent attendance and punctuality.
  • Maintain work area per plant standard for safety, efficiency and cleanliness.
  • Attend safety meetings and abide by all safety rules set forth by company and governmental regulatory agencies; ensures that hazardous conditions are reported and corrected.
  • All other tasks and/or responsibilities as assigned. 

 

Successful candidates will have: 

  • High school education or equivalent.
  • 4-10 years of experience in the electrical field.
  • Ability to operate forklift, front-end loader and any other equipment required to perform duties.

 

PABCO offers an excellent benefits and compensation package including medical, dental, vision, 401(k), profit sharing retirement plan and wellness programs.  

 

We are an equal opportunity employer and promote a drug free workplace.

  • Must have open availability and Weekend availability is required. Typically, the shift is 6 am – 2:30 pm but in the event of long projects or emergencies, we may require longer shifts.
  • Probability of Call-In, Overtime and Nights / Weekends.
  • Pay Range depends on experience, which is determined through the interview process: $34.64 - $46.68 (there are levels within this range).
